Where does “Anthocerotopsida” come from?

Anthocerotopsida (Translingual) comes from Translingual Anthoceros, from Translingual antho-, from Ancient Greek ἄνθος, from Proto-Hellenic ántʰos, from Proto-Indo-European h₂éndʰos, from Proto-Indo-European -os — Creates action nouns or result nouns from verbs;...
